Pedaling Through Nashville’s Urban Wild: Biking the Cumberland River Greenway
Tracing nearly 12 miles along the winding curves of the Cumberland River, Nashville’s Cumberland River Greenway offers an invigorating bike ride that threads the city’s pulse with its raw natural edge. This greenway isn’t just a trail — it's an urban wild daring you to explore its restless waters, whispering trees, and riverbanks sculpted by time and tide.
Starting near downtown Nashville, the trail launches under the watchful gaze of skyscrapers before giving way to stretches where hardwoods lean over shaded pathways. The greenway undulates gently, with an elevation gain of about 150 feet, manageable but enough to engage your legs and eyes alike. Expect smooth paved surfaces interspersed with wooden boardwalk sections skimming wetlands where the river presses close, almost brushing your tires.
The greenway’s character shifts as you ride: at times, the river acts as a guide, its currents pushing forward, enticing exploration; elsewhere, urban sounds fade to the hum of insects and chirping birds perched in gnarled branches. Look carefully — raccoons and river otters are frequent, curious residents along the banks.
Access points pepper the route, including parks with restroom facilities and bike repair stations, ensuring practical comfort to keep your ride seamless. The ride is ideal between 6 to 8 miles one-way, with options to extend based on stamina and curiosity. Helmets are necessary; hydration a must, especially through summer months when Tennessee’s heat clings firmly to the air. Early morning or late afternoon rides minimize sun exposure and reveal the river’s best light.
While it's a primarily flat, family-friendly route, moderate fitness improves your experience, especially when gusts from the river challenge your pace. Footwear should be comfortable and supportive—think breathable sneakers, not trail-specific shoes.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is the Cumberland River Greenway suitable for beginner cyclists?
Yes, the trail is mostly flat and paved, making it accessible for beginners. However, some wooden boardwalk sections require careful navigation. Moderate fitness helps enjoy the full length comfortably.
Are there restroom and water refill stations along the greenway?
Yes, public parks with restrooms and water fountains are located at several access points, including riverfront parks near downtown and further upstream.
Can the greenway be accessed by public transportation?
Several bus routes connect the downtown area to trailheads near the greenway, making it feasible to plan a ride without a personal vehicle.
What wildlife might I encounter on the ride?
Expect to see raccoons, river otters, various songbirds, and sometimes turtles sunbathing near the water's edge. In spring and fall, migratory waterfowl add to the scene.
Are pets allowed on the Cumberland River Greenway?
Yes, dogs on leashes are welcome. Carry water and waste bags, and be aware of local wildlife to avoid disturbing natural habitats.
Is the greenway open year-round?
The trail is open throughout the year, but sections might occasionally close for maintenance or flooding, especially after heavy spring rains.
